FIELD: driver monitoring systems.
SUBSTANCE: invention relates to a method for monitoring the state of the driver when driving. The method includes preliminary collection of data on vehicle control parameters by measuring means and their comparison with current data. Data is obtained in the process of driving a vehicle. In the process of driving a vehicle, the psychophysiological parameters of the driver are determined and evaluated. Preliminary data and responses are obtained outside of driving, while driving, while driving in an irritated state, while driving under the influence of alcohol, and while driving in a fatigued state. As the psychophysiological parameters of the driver, the direction of gaze, blinking frequency, pulse, blood pressure, driver reaction time and the presence of ethyl alcohol vapours are determined and evaluated. As vehicle control parameters, the longitudinal accelerations and decelerations of the vehicle and the frequency of rebuilding of the vehicle when driving on the road are determined and evaluated.
EFFECT: increase in the accuracy of determining the state of the driver is achieved.
